This shift toward hyper-personalization is real — and it’s happening fast. Companies like Netflix and Spotify have set the bar sky-high by using AI to predict what people want before they even ask. Now, customers expect that same level of intuitive service everywhere they go.
According to Medallia’s 2025 customer experience trends, brands that can deliver genuine hyper-personalized experiences — using smart data, not just assumptions — will be the ones that win lasting loyalty.
The good news?
You don’t need a Silicon Valley budget to personalize in a meaningful way. Simple, thoughtful touches like remembering past purchases, offering product suggestions that actually make sense, or sending a thank-you note after a big order go a long way.
The takeaway
Customers in 2025 aren’t looking for more spammy emails or cookie-cutter marketing. They’re looking for experiences that feel made just for them. If you meet them there, they’ll meet you with loyalty.
